A member asked:

When do you see an endrocinoligist?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Usually by referral: Most times someone sees an endocrinologist because of referral by the primary care md. Endocrinologists take care of organs that produce hormones to control body functions such as the throid, the pancreas (diabetes), the parathyroid (calcium control), sexual hormones, and sometimes unexplained obesity. There usually is a reason to see them determined by your md.
